Assessing Your Home's Solar Potential
Before diving right into solar panel installment, you need to examine your home's solar possibility. Beginning by examining your roof covering's alignment and slope; south-facing roofs usually catch the most sunshine.
Try to find any type of obstructions, like trees or tall buildings, that might cast darkness on your panels. These can substantially minimize energy manufacturing. Consider your local climate as well; bright areas generate far better results than constantly gloomy areas.
Next, assess your power demands and usage patterns to establish the number of panels you'll need. You could also intend to make use of on-line solar calculators or consult with an expert to get a clearer photo.

Zoning Regulation Compliance
When thinking about solar panel setup, understanding zoning regulations and neighborhood regulations is crucial to ensuring a smooth process.
Before making any kind of decisions, you need to consult your city government or zoning workplace to learn any type of limitations that may put on your property. These laws can determine where you can position your solar panels, exactly how high they can be, and whether you need extra authorizations.
Realize that some communities or property owners' organizations might have their very own regulations relating to solar power systems. By familiarizing on your own with these policies ahead of time, you can stay clear of prospective penalties or pricey changes later on.
Inevitably, adhering to zoning regulations sets a strong structure for your solar job, guaranteeing it lines up with community standards.
Permit Application Process
Browsing the permit application process is a crucial action after ensuring compliance with zoning regulations.
You'll need to inspect your local laws to identify what permits are required for solar panel installation. This typically includes structure authorizations, electric permits, and potentially also unique permits depending on your location.
Do not neglect to gather required papers like site strategies and specifications for the solar tools.
When you have actually filled in the needed forms, send your application to your neighborhood authority.
Be planned for feasible evaluations, as officials might intend to confirm compliance with safety and security and building ordinance.
It's also wise to stay in touch with your regional office throughout this process to resolve any questions or concerns they may have.
Reviewing Your Power Needs and Consumption
How can you establish the best solar panel system for your home? Begin by examining your energy requirements and consumption.
Check out your utility expenses over the past year to understand your ordinary monthly usage. This'll offer you a standard for just how much power you need to generate. Do not fail to remember to take into consideration seasonal variants; your energy needs could spike in summer season or wintertime.
Next off, think about any kind of future changes, like including appliances or electric cars, which might boost your intake.
Exploring Financial Rewards and Tax Credit Histories
Before you devote to installing solar panels, it's important to explore the economic motivations and tax obligation credit ratings offered to you. Federal and state governments usually provide significant tax debts to offset installment expenses.
For example, the federal solar tax obligation debt can cover a percentage of your expenditures, allowing you to save thousands. Furthermore, several states provide refunds or gives to urge solar adoption, which can even more decrease your preliminary investment.
Utility firms might additionally have incentive programs that award you for generating solar power. Study these choices thoroughly and speak with a tax specialist to maximize your financial savings.

Panel Efficiency Scores
As you check out the globe of solar panels, understanding panel efficiency scores is crucial for making a notified decision. These rankings suggest just how successfully a panel converts sunlight into usable power. The greater the efficiency, the much more energy you'll create from a smaller sized room. Most domestic panels vary from 15% to 22% performance.
When selecting your panels, consider your power needs and offered roofing space. If you have limited room, selecting higher-efficiency panels could be advantageous. Nevertheless, if you have sufficient roofing system area, lower-efficiency panels may be adequate.
Setup Type Choices
Picking the best installation kind for solar panels can considerably influence your system's performance and performance. You'll typically encounter two primary choices: roof-mounted and ground-mounted systems.
Roof-mounted panels are commonly the best choice for homeowners, as they use existing space and can be less costly to install. Nevertheless, if your roof isn't appropriate-- probably due to shading or structural issues-- ground-mounted systems could be the much better alternative.
They allow for ideal positioning, making best use of sunshine exposure. Additionally, you can adjust their angle to improve effectiveness.
Prior to determining, take into consideration variables like available space, spending plan, and local policies. By reviewing these alternatives thoroughly, you'll ensure your solar panel installment fulfills your power requires properly.
Visual Factors to consider
While functionality is important, visual appeals shouldn't be forgotten when selecting solar panels for your home. You want panels that not only work successfully yet also enhance your home's design.
Take into consideration the color and size of the solar panels; black panels frequently blend flawlessly with dark roofs, while blue panels might stand out extra. Explore alternatives like building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PV) that change typical roof materials, using a streamlined look.
You could likewise check out solar shingles, which mimic basic roof covering and can improve visual allure. Don't neglect to analyze the format and placement of the panels to make the most of both efficiency and visual harmony.
Eventually, striking the right equilibrium in between performance and looks will certainly make your solar financial investment a lot more gratifying.
Taking Into Consideration Setup Prices and Financing Alternatives
Before diving into solar panel installation, it's crucial to assess the linked expenses and offered financing options.
solar panel systems can range extensively in rate, so you'll intend to obtain a clear quote of installment expenses, including devices, labor, and any type of required permits. Check out regional incentives or tax obligation credits that might balance out these costs.
Financing options vary; you could take into consideration buying outright, leasing, or checking out solar fundings. Each selection has its advantages and disadvantages, impacting your long-term cost savings and cash flow.
Make sure to compare rates of interest and terms if you're funding. Understanding your budget and financing alternatives will assist you make an educated choice and optimize your investment in solar energy.

Preparation for Upkeep and Long-lasting Performance
Selecting a trusted solar installer establishes the foundation for your solar panel system, yet planning for upkeep and long-term performance is equally as essential.
Routine upkeep can expand the life of your solar panels and ensure they run at peak effectiveness. Think about organizing annual evaluations to look for particles, damage, or put on.
Likewise, familiarize on your own with the service warranty and service contracts; recognizing what's covered can conserve you cash down the line. Watch on your power manufacturing, as a sudden decrease may suggest a trouble.
Ultimately, remain notified concerning technical advancements; updating components can improve efficiency and effectiveness, inevitably optimizing your investment in solar power.
